
St. Thomas, U.S. Virgin Islands– On Wednesday, April 23, 2025, at approximately 3:42 p.m.
officers from the Virgin Islands Police Department Special Operations Bureau conducted a
traffic stop on Veterans Drive after observing a vehicle with excessive tint on the front
windshield, a violation of local traffic laws.
During the stop, officers detected a strong odor of marijuana emanating from the vehicle.
As the driver, 32-year-old Kenney Linton, rolled down the window, officers observed a
container inside the vehicle. Upon further investigation and a subsequent search, officers
discovered approximately one pound of marijuana.
Mr. Linton admitted ownership of the marijuana and was placed under arrest for Possession
of a Controlled Substance with Intent to Distribute. He was also cited for window tint
violations. Mr. Linton was transported to the Richard N. Callwood Command, booked, and
remanded to the Bureau of Corrections pending his Advice of Rights Hearing scheduled for
Thursday, April 24, 2025.
